Take a look behind-the-scenes of our brand campaign with Halfords, one of the UK’s largest retailers.

In 2021 we produced 27 product videos for Halfords as well as a full brand advert for the whole range of bikes. Our brief was to represent the Carrera Brand in the correct way giving a sense of adventure and not sticking to the standard format of cutting shots over a basic soundtrack. We designed and pitched a concept to Halfords in late November 2020 that included graphics and immersive sound design to tighten the production and break the norm of what they have had made before.

We got the green light in December 2020 and the majority of the start of 2021 we were into pre-production.

Pre-production is a crucial time for any project. This is where it can be won or lost in certain ways and with such a complex and vast project it was crucial we got this right. We had to film the full range in different locations across the UK with different models making sure we kept to the client brief.

Our first task was to work out where we could film and for the right costs (location permits can be expensive!). During this time we scouted across Wales and the UK, booked the locations and shortlisted our models. With certain bikes such as road and mountain bikes we needed competent riders who could really show them off to their full potential. We carried out many test shoots with different camera rigs to ensure we would get the right results when filming for real!. You can see the Tilta Hydra Alien being used in the video above. This was modified so we could use it for filming our road bikes in Wales.


We brought in some fantastic camera guys and production assistants to add to our crew and an expert bike photographer in Doc Ward who helped us get those dynamic and striking stills.

Production started in June 2021.

We filmed across some stunning locations throughout the summer months, including Elan Valley, Antur Stiniog in Snowdonia, Forest of Dean, Bristol City Centre, Ashton Court Estate and Pittville Park in Cheltenham. It felt great to be able to take a crew of people out on these shoots and work within some incredible scenery. Sometimes you take the UK for granted but after the numerous lockdowns and being stuck in doors with work halted, you really appreciate what is just on your doorstep!.
